Needs Medicine Reconciliation!!!

To review a note, check a lab, or place a quick order, this app is OK. However, the addition of medicine reconciliation capacity would vault this app into incredibly useful. For providers with high volume clinics, medical reconciliation compromises a tremendous amount of time and mouse clicks. To be able to do this easily on the go would be a game changer for efficiency. And would be a much more realistic utilization, than attempting to document within the app, especially as AI becomes more of an assistant for documentation.

This app needs: Micro view and increased ordering ability

Why is the micro tab conveniently missing? It needs to be there to make antibiotic decisions moving forward. Also, why is the ability to order things limited? Please add the ability to order fluids. As of now we can only cancel them. At some point in the very near future, please add the ability to order/edit power plans. Also make the app faster overall.
